In FLAC, the debut album reveals its AOR (Album-Oriented Rock) roots. Listen to the harmonica intro on “Should’ve Known Better” – in lossless audio, you can hear the reed vibration and Marx’s finger positioning. The low-end on “Don’t Mean Nothing” (featuring a young Fee Waybill) finally punches through without the muddiness of compressed formats.

Rush Street shifted toward a more organic, blues-influenced pop-rock sound. The cinematic masterpiece "Hazard" uses an eerie, atmospheric synthesizer layer beneath a crisp, pulsing acoustic guitar line. Lossless compression allows listeners to pick out the subtle bass movements and the distinct layering of Luther Vandross’s backing vocals on "Keep Coming Back". 4. True FLAC files converted from a CD source will show a clean frequency cutoff at 22.1 kHz. If the audio spectrum cuts off sharply at 16 kHz or 20 kHz, the file is likely a "transcode" (a low-quality MP3 converted into a FLAC container).
